Author: twerner
Date: 2008-11-19 07:44:07 +0000 (Wed, 19 Nov 2008)
New Revision: 7387

Added:
   trunk/libjboss-buildmagic-java/debian/patches/
   trunk/libjboss-buildmagic-java/debian/patches/ant.diff
   trunk/libjboss-buildmagic-java/debian/patches/no-common.diff
   trunk/libjboss-buildmagic-java/debian/patches/series
   trunk/libjboss-buildmagic-java/debian/watch
Modified:
   trunk/libjboss-buildmagic-java/debian/ant.properties
   trunk/libjboss-buildmagic-java/debian/build.xml
   trunk/libjboss-buildmagic-java/debian/changelog
   trunk/libjboss-buildmagic-java/debian/control
   trunk/libjboss-buildmagic-java/debian/copyright
   trunk/libjboss-buildmagic-java/debian/orig-tar.sh
   trunk/libjboss-buildmagic-java/debian/rules
Log:
switch to version 2.0.1


Modified: trunk/libjboss-buildmagic-java/debian/ant.properties
===================================================================
--- trunk/libjboss-buildmagic-java/debian/ant.properties        2008-11-19 
06:31:42 UTC (rev 7386)
+++ trunk/libjboss-buildmagic-java/debian/ant.properties        2008-11-19 
07:44:07 UTC (rev 7387)
@@ -1 +1 @@
-project.name=jboss-build
+project.name=jboss-buildmagic

Modified: trunk/libjboss-buildmagic-java/debian/build.xml
===================================================================
--- trunk/libjboss-buildmagic-java/debian/build.xml     2008-11-19 06:31:42 UTC 
(rev 7386)
+++ trunk/libjboss-buildmagic-java/debian/build.xml     2008-11-19 07:44:07 UTC 
(rev 7387)
@@ -3,13 +3,13 @@
 <project default="jar" name="${project.name}" basedir="..">
 
   <target name="clean">
-    <ant dir="jbossbuild" target="clean"/>
-    <ant dir="buildmagic/tasks" target="clean"/>
+    <ant dir="common" target="clean"/>
+    <ant dir="tasks" target="clean"/>
   </target>
 
   <target name="jar" description="o Create the jars">
-    <ant dir="jbossbuild"/>
-    <ant dir="buildmagic/tasks"/>
+    <ant dir="common"/>
+    <ant dir="tasks"/>
   </target>
 
 </project>

Modified: trunk/libjboss-buildmagic-java/debian/changelog
===================================================================
--- trunk/libjboss-buildmagic-java/debian/changelog     2008-11-19 06:31:42 UTC 
(rev 7386)
+++ trunk/libjboss-buildmagic-java/debian/changelog     2008-11-19 07:44:07 UTC 
(rev 7387)
@@ -1,5 +1,5 @@
-libjboss-build-java (20071201-1) unstable; urgency=low
+libjboss-buildmagic-java (2.0.1-1) unstable; urgency=low
 
   * initial version (Closes: #385500)
 
- -- Torsten Werner <[EMAIL PROTECTED]>  Sat, 01 Dec 2007 12:23:34 +0100
+ -- Torsten Werner <[EMAIL PROTECTED]>  Wed, 19 Nov 2008 07:33:15 +0100

Modified: trunk/libjboss-buildmagic-java/debian/control
===================================================================
--- trunk/libjboss-buildmagic-java/debian/control       2008-11-19 06:31:42 UTC 
(rev 7386)
+++ trunk/libjboss-buildmagic-java/debian/control       2008-11-19 07:44:07 UTC 
(rev 7387)
@@ -1,16 +1,17 @@
-Source: libjboss-build-java
+Source: libjboss-buildmagic-java
 Section: libs
 Priority: optional
 Maintainer: Debian Java Maintainers <[EMAIL PROTECTED]>
 Uploaders: Torsten Werner <[EMAIL PROTECTED]>
-Build-Depends: debhelper (>= 5), cdbs
-Build-Depends-Indep: ant, java-gcj-compat-dev, junit4,
- libjboss-common-java
-Standards-Version: 3.7.2
-Vcs-Svn: svn://svn.debian.org/svn/pkg-java/trunk/libjboss-build-java
-Vcs-Browser: http://svn.debian.org/wsvn/pkg-java/trunk/libjboss-build-java
+Build-Depends: debhelper (>= 5), cdbs, quilt, libxerces2-java, junit4
+Build-Depends-Indep: ant, default-jdk
+Standards-Version: 3.8.0
+Vcs-Svn: svn://svn.debian.org/svn/pkg-java/trunk/libjboss-buildmagic-java
+Vcs-Browser: http://svn.debian.org/wsvn/pkg-java/trunk/libjboss-buildmagic-java
 
-Package: libjboss-build-java
+Package: libjboss-buildmagic-java
 Architecture: all
-Depends:  java-gcj-compat | java1-runtime | java2-runtime
-Description: FIXME
+Depends: ${misc:Depends}, default-java | java2-runtime
+Description: JBoss buildmagic module
+ This package ships the buildmagic common and tasks module which is needed to
+ build the JBoss application server.

Modified: trunk/libjboss-buildmagic-java/debian/copyright
===================================================================
--- trunk/libjboss-buildmagic-java/debian/copyright     2008-11-19 06:31:42 UTC 
(rev 7386)
+++ trunk/libjboss-buildmagic-java/debian/copyright     2008-11-19 07:44:07 UTC 
(rev 7387)
@@ -1,12 +1,24 @@
-FIXME
 This package was debianized by Torsten Werner <[EMAIL PROTECTED]> on
-Mon, 26 Nov 2007 16:31:34 +0100.
+Wed Nov 19 07:35:18 CET 2008.
 
-It was downloaded from http://www.picocontainer.org
+It was downloaded from
+<http://anonsvn.labs.jboss.com/labs/jbossbuild/buildmagic/>.
 
-Upstream Authors: Paul Hammant, Konstantin Pribluda, Jörg Schaible,
-Mauro Talevi, Michael Ward, Michael Rimov, Jose Peleteiro
+Copyright: (C) 2005-2007 JBoss Inc.
+           (C) 2008 Red Hat Middleware, LLC. All rights reserved. 
 
-Picocontainer is licensed under the BSD license which can be found in
-/usr/share/common-licenses/BSD on Debian GNU/Linux systems.
+License:
+    This library is free software; you can redistribute it and/or modify
+    it under the terms of the GNU Lesser General Public License as
+    published by the Free Software Foundation; either version 2.1 of
+    the License, or (at your option) any later version.
 
+    This library is distributed in the hope that it will be useful,
+    but WITHOUT ANY WARRANTY; without even the implied warranty of
+    M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the GNU
+    Lesser General Public License for more details.
+
+On Debian systems, full text of the LGPL license can be found at
+`/usr/share/common-licenses/LGPL-2.1'.
+
+MORE FIXME

Modified: trunk/libjboss-buildmagic-java/debian/orig-tar.sh
===================================================================
--- trunk/libjboss-buildmagic-java/debian/orig-tar.sh   2008-11-19 06:31:42 UTC 
(rev 7386)
+++ trunk/libjboss-buildmagic-java/debian/orig-tar.sh   2008-11-19 07:44:07 UTC 
(rev 7387)
@@ -1,17 +1,12 @@
 #!/bin/sh -e
 
-VERSION=$(dpkg-parsechangelog | sed -ne 's,^Version: \(.*\)-.*,\1,p')
-SOURCE=$(dpkg-parsechangelog | sed -ne 's,Source: \(.*\),\1,p')
-DIR=${SOURCE}-${VERSION}
-TAR=../${SOURCE}_${VERSION}.orig.tar.gz
+DIR=buildmagic-$2
+TAR=../libjboss-buildmagic-java_$2.orig.tar.gz
 
-export CVSROOT=:pserver:[EMAIL PROTECTED]:/cvsroot/jboss
-mkdir $DIR
-(cd $DIR &&
-  cvs export -D $VERSION buildmagic &&
-  cvs export -D $VERSION jbossbuild)
-tar -c -z -f $TAR --exclude '*.class' --exclude '*.jar' $DIR
-rm -rf $DIR
+# clean up the upstream tarball
+svn export http://anonsvn.labs.jboss.com/labs/jbossbuild/buildmagic/tags/$DIR 
$DIR
+tar -c -z -f $TAR $DIR
+rm -rf $DIR $3
 
 # move to directory 'tarballs'
 if [ -r .svn/deb-layout ]; then
@@ -20,4 +15,3 @@
     echo "moved $TAR to $origDir"
 fi
 
-exit 0

Added: trunk/libjboss-buildmagic-java/debian/patches/ant.diff
===================================================================
--- trunk/libjboss-buildmagic-java/debian/patches/ant.diff                      
        (rev 0)
+++ trunk/libjboss-buildmagic-java/debian/patches/ant.diff      2008-11-19 
07:44:07 UTC (rev 7387)
@@ -0,0 +1,21 @@
+Index: libjboss-buildmagic-java-2.0.1/tools/etc/buildmagic/buildmagic.ent
+===================================================================
+--- libjboss-buildmagic-java-2.0.1.orig/tools/etc/buildmagic/buildmagic.ent    
2008-11-19 08:07:46.000000000 +0100
++++ libjboss-buildmagic-java-2.0.1/tools/etc/buildmagic/buildmagic.ent 
2008-11-19 08:08:06.000000000 +0100
+@@ -10,6 +10,7 @@
+   <!-- Make sure we have the right version of Ant -->
+   <property name="buildmagic.ant15.baseversion" value="1.5"/>
+   <property name="buildmagic.ant16.baseversion" value="1.6"/>
++  <property name="buildmagic.ant17.baseversion" value="1.7"/>
+ 
+   <!--
+      | Add new conditions for other supported Ant versions when they
+@@ -22,6 +23,8 @@
+         substring="Ant version ${buildmagic.ant15.baseversion}"/>
+       <contains string="${ant.version}"
+         substring="Ant version ${buildmagic.ant16.baseversion}"/>
++      <contains string="${ant.version}"
++        substring="Ant version ${buildmagic.ant17.baseversion}"/>
+     </or>
+   </condition>
+ 

Added: trunk/libjboss-buildmagic-java/debian/patches/no-common.diff
===================================================================
--- trunk/libjboss-buildmagic-java/debian/patches/no-common.diff                
                (rev 0)
+++ trunk/libjboss-buildmagic-java/debian/patches/no-common.diff        
2008-11-19 07:44:07 UTC (rev 7387)
@@ -0,0 +1,13 @@
+Index: libjboss-buildmagic-java-2.0.1/tasks/build.xml
+===================================================================
+--- libjboss-buildmagic-java-2.0.1.orig/tasks/build.xml        2008-11-19 
08:14:21.000000000 +0100
++++ libjboss-buildmagic-java-2.0.1/tasks/build.xml     2008-11-19 
08:19:15.000000000 +0100
+@@ -75,8 +75,6 @@
+                     version="1.2.4"/>
+         <dependency groupId="bsf" artifactId="bsf"
+                         version="2.2" />
+-      <dependency groupId="jboss" artifactId="jboss-common"
+-                version="1.0.3.GA" />
+       </artifact:dependencies>
+       
+     <!--<dependency-manager 

Added: trunk/libjboss-buildmagic-java/debian/patches/series
===================================================================
--- trunk/libjboss-buildmagic-java/debian/patches/series                        
        (rev 0)
+++ trunk/libjboss-buildmagic-java/debian/patches/series        2008-11-19 
07:44:07 UTC (rev 7387)
@@ -0,0 +1,2 @@
+ant.diff
+no-common.diff

Modified: trunk/libjboss-buildmagic-java/debian/rules
===================================================================
--- trunk/libjboss-buildmagic-java/debian/rules 2008-11-19 06:31:42 UTC (rev 
7386)
+++ trunk/libjboss-buildmagic-java/debian/rules 2008-11-19 07:44:07 UTC (rev 
7387)
@@ -1,16 +1,20 @@
 #!/usr/bin/make -f
 
+include /usr/share/cdbs/1/rules/debhelper.mk
 include /usr/share/cdbs/1/class/ant.mk
-include /usr/share/cdbs/1/rules/debhelper.mk
+include /usr/share/cdbs/1/rules/patchsys-quilt.mk
 
-JAVA_HOME         := /usr/lib/jvm/java-gcj
+JAVA_HOME         := /usr/lib/jvm/default-java
 DEB_ANT_BUILDFILE := debian/build.xml
-DEB_JARS          := ant junit4 jboss-common
+DEB_JARS          := ant-nodeps xercesImpl junit4 ant-junit
+DEB_CLASSPATH     := $(DEB_CLASSPATH):common/output/classes/
 
-#FIXME
-install/libpicocontainer-java:: 
-       install -m644 -D picocontainer.jar 
$(DEB_DESTDIR)/usr/share/java/picocontainer-$(DEB_UPSTREAM_VERSION).jar
-       dh_link -plibpicocontainer-java 
/usr/share/java/picocontainer-$(DEB_UPSTREAM_VERSION).jar 
/usr/share/java/picocontainer.jar
+install/libjboss-buildmagic-java:: 
+       install -m644 -D tasks/output/lib/buildmagic-tasks.jar \
+         
$(DEB_DESTDIR)/usr/share/java/buildmagic-tasks-$(DEB_UPSTREAM_VERSION).jar
+       dh_link -plibjboss-buildmagic-java \
+         /usr/share/java/buildmagic-tasks-$(DEB_UPSTREAM_VERSION).jar \
+         /usr/share/java/buildmagic-tasks.jar
 
 get-orig-source:
        sh debian/orig-tar.sh

Added: trunk/libjboss-buildmagic-java/debian/watch
===================================================================
--- trunk/libjboss-buildmagic-java/debian/watch                         (rev 0)
+++ trunk/libjboss-buildmagic-java/debian/watch 2008-11-19 07:44:07 UTC (rev 
7387)
@@ -0,0 +1,4 @@
+version=3
+
+http://anonsvn.labs.jboss.com/labs/jbossbuild/buildmagic/tags/ \
+  buildmagic-([\d.]+)/ debian debian/orig-tar.sh


_______________________________________________
pkg-java-commits mailing list
[email protected]
http://lists.alioth.debian.org/mailman/listinfo/pkg-java-commits

Reply via email to